Set Up Alerts Like a Pro

Follow key accounts: team analysts, former bowlers, die‑hard fans. Use Twitter lists to isolate “insider” voices. Enable push notifications for breaking news. Here is the deal: a single tweet about a pitch change can flip a market in seconds.

Hashtag Mining

#PitchReport, #TeamNews, #PlayerForm—these aren’t just trends, they’re data points. Scan them in real time, note spikes, cross‑reference with official line‑ups. If #PlayerForm spikes before a match, that’s a confidence signal you can monetize.

Cross‑Reference With Traditional Sources

Never trust a single tweet. Blend social buzz with official stats, weather forecasts, and historical matchups. The sweet spot—where social confidence meets statistical probability—creates the profitable overlap.

Build a Personal Dashboard

Aggregate feeds into a single view. Use a spreadsheet or a lightweight app to log timestamps, source, sentiment, and outcome. Over weeks, patterns emerge. You’ll spot which accounts consistently predict winners, which hashtags precede upsets.
